Practical Production Considerations
Stars Moon Rainbow Cloud and Sun is generally easy to understand at a glance, making it ideal for batch production. It works well as both a small accent and a large focal point, depending on the size of the item. However, users should be mindful of stitch density, especially in areas with intricate details like the rainbow or cloud shapes.
Thread color contrast is important—using light threads on dark fabrics can help the design pop, while darker threads on light backgrounds create a more subtle effect. The hoop size required for this design will depend on the item being embroidered, so testing on scrap fabric is always recommended.
Careful-Use Notes for Embroidery Designers
Some areas of the design may have dense stitch areas that could cause puckering on certain fabrics. Tiny details, such as the stars or individual raindrops, may not hold up well on textured towels or thick fabrics. For curved cap surfaces, the design might require slight adjustments to ensure proper placement and visibility.
Dark fabric applications need careful consideration, as some elements of the design may lose clarity. Smaller sizes of the design may also result in a loss of detail, so it's best to test at different scales before mass production.

Embroidery Designer Tips for Success
Before starting production, it’s essential to test the embroidery file on scrap fabric to ensure the design looks as intended. Checking thread colors against the fabric is crucial for achieving the desired effect. Reviewing spacing and stitch density helps prevent issues during the embroidery process.
Using the right stabilizer is key, especially when working with delicate or stretchy fabrics. Creating at least one real mockup allows you to see how the design appears in person, which is invaluable for making adjustments before finalizing your product line.
Comparing fabric colors and confirming commercial licensing before selling finished products is a must. This ensures that your handmade items meet legal standards and maintain the quality expected by customers.
